The Manufacturing Operational Technology Project Manager will lead and manage projects related to the implementation, integration, and optimization of IT/OT systems within manufacturing environments. This role involves coordinating with cross-functional teams, managing project timelines, budgets, and resources, and ensuring that project goals are met in alignment with organizational objectives.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in automation, process control, and system integration, with a focus on optimizing manufacturing efficiency and ensuring high levels of system reliability and performance.

QUALIFICATIONS
Bachelor's degree in engineering,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related field, or equivalent experience in the industry . A master's degree is a plus.
7-10 years with various manufacturing controls and digital systems (PLCs, OT, SCADA, MES, SAP, etc.).
At least 5-10 years of experience as a technical project manager or product owner in the smart manufacturing space.
Experience with, and understanding of Industrial Control Systems, Programmable Logic Controls (PLCs) and Human Machine Interface (HMI) and SCADA.
Hands-on smart manufacturing and/or digital transformation project implementation experience is preferred.
